Just click on play and the video clip will open a link to YouTube and play the video without leaving this web page.If you can recall last year's music then one song will come to play and that song is 'Tong Ting'. It was a favorite for many last year because Cassie's style came off as something that was different but, at the same time, fresh and exciting.

However, Cassie stated in a recent 'Metro' article that he was not pleased with last year's performance. He intended that 2012 should be different. Personally, I like both tracks and for this post I am posting both songs with this year's song "Inside the Party" featured first. However, if you watch the video for "Inside the Party" you would notice the recall of 'Tong Ting' and the transition into his latest release.

Cassie has a style of singing that is different and even his voice is unmistakable. Taken together, Cassiano "Cassie" Sylvester and his producer "Char Su" have a very unique style of music that stands out in a market of copy cats. The identity of Trinidad and Tobago' music is in transition and taking into consideration Cassie and Char Su's unique styley  we have no doubt that they would fit in nicely and continue to bring sweet music inside the party.


Production Notes:
Name of Song: Inside The Party
Written by: Cassiano Sysvester
Produced by: Richard "Shar Su" Ahong
